well my carrier bearing wend out so i decided to tackle the job my self. everything was going pretty good until i removed my brake rotor and the thing the break rotor mounts to i can't get if off the axle. how do you get it off? does it have to slide down the splines on the axle? i tryed to work it off with a screw driver but that got me no were so i would like so tips on how to get it off?

After you have removed the metal band on the axle(well its not a "C" clip I don't know what it's called)take a mallet and tap on the end of the axle toward the chain and it will start to move.

i had the same problem i know this is gonna sound crazy but it worked for me...


i had the same part stuck (brake hub) i beat that thing with a hammer, screw driver, etc nothing would move it... i went to take the swing arm off and take it somewhere to be pressed off the axle... took the swing arm off so i could carry it away and i set the swing arm down on the axle while i bent down to grab something... when i set it down on the brake side of the axle parrel to the ground the weight of the swing arm pushing down popped it free... so if worst comes to worst take ur swing arm off and set it down on it side so the weight of the swing arm pushes it off... just have someone holding the swing arm so it don't go flying down to the ground like mine did crushing my foot...
